Output ec6912344597dde4941d352d6a8fd22b3e9ac193a18cb6781b79637e8d59ee28:181

value
10897
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 80da8cbe6fc7bec94e2c45d0ed0c2e820c7afc462e7dec45b059958e4e4f3bfb
address
bc1psrdge0n0c7lvjn3vghgw6rpwsgx84lzx9e77c3dstx2cunj080asyd2xmp
transaction
ec6912344597dde4941d352d6a8fd22b3e9ac193a18cb6781b79637e8d59ee28
confirmations
93064
spent
true